It is a high performance Layer 1 that utilizes the Solana Virtual Machine. That choice alone reveals a lot about its direction and philosophy.

The Solana Virtual Machine is known for its efficiency and its ability to process transactions in parallel rather than one by one. In simple words this means the network can handle many actions at the same time instead of forcing them into a single waiting line. Fogo builds around this execution environment to create a network that aims for high throughput and low latency. Throughput refers to how many transactions a network can handle within a certain time. Latency refers to how quickly those transactions are confirmed. When both are optimized the result is a chain that feels responsive. That responsiveness is critical if Web3 wants to compete with traditional systems that people already trust and use daily.

One of the aspects I find most meaningful about Fogo is how it reduces friction for developers. Builders who are already familiar with the Solana Virtual Machine ecosystem can transition more easily. They do not need to abandon their knowledge or relearn everything from the beginning. That continuity encourages innovation because developers can focus on creating applications instead of struggling with unfamiliar infrastructure. When builders feel supported the entire ecosystem benefits.

Fogo is designed to support applications that require speed and reliability. Decentralized exchanges need rapid execution to handle market movements. Onchain games require instant responsiveness to keep players engaged. Marketplaces must process large volumes of interactions without delay. Financial platforms often demand near real time settlement. These are not optional features. They are expectations. A high performance Layer 1 like Fogo positions itself to meet those expectations directly at the base layer rather than relying heavily on external scaling solutions.
